Some implementation details

CRM Admin Dashboard full view

CSS3 flex boxes and grid system were heavily used with the former being more rampant.

.carrotsuite-nav is a flex container which is the baseline of the header. Header elements are composed of mainly fontawesome icons. The site's logo wrapper was absolutely positioned to aid easy positioning.

main

.main was made a grid container with its columns made 28rem 2fr.

The first column houses the fixed .sidebar whose .menu was made a flex container to ensure that the icons and their corresponding texts are horizontally aligned. A subtle animation was chipped in which puts up only the icons, with the texts used as their title using the only few lines of JavaScript that the code base has when the viewport collapses to some breakpoint.

Smaller screen page

.page-content occupies the remaining grid column followed by other conventional styles. The only thing worth noting is the animated .dropbtn which rotates fontawesome's arrow-up icon -180deg on hover.
